Matcha should be stored carefully to preserve its freshness, quality, and flavor. Here are some tips for proper storage:
1. Airtight packaging: Store Store the matcha in an airtight package to minimize contact with air and avoid loss of quality.
2. Dark place: Store matcha in a dark place, such as a cupboard, pantry, or refrigerator, to reduce the effects of light and preserve its quality.
3. Cool temperature: Matcha should be stored at cool temperatures, away from heat sources such as stoves or ovens. A cool room or the refrigerator are suitable storage locations.
4. Dry environment: Avoid moisture, as this can negatively affect matcha. Therefore, store it in a dry environment and avoid places with high humidity.
5. Original packaging: Ideally, store matcha in its original packaging or an airtight container to minimize external influences and preserve freshness.
By following these guidelines, you can ensure that your matcha retains its best quality and taste.
